With an IRA, any money withdrawn before the age of 59 1/2 is subject to a 10% penalty, plus federal, state and local taxes on that amount. A traditional IRA (individual retirement account) allows individuals to direct pre-tax income toward investments that can grow tax-deferred. Both the 401(k) and IRA are retirement accounts so they are structured to discourage early withdrawals. You can withdraw money early from an IRA without penalty for a few specific reasons, such as placing a down payment on a first home or paying for college tuition. A premature distribution is one taken from an IRA, qualified plan, or tax-deferred annuity that is paid to a beneficiary that is under age 59½.
